quot Can quot is one of the most commonly used modal verbs in English It can be used to express ability or opportunity to request or offer permission and to show possibility or impossibility We sometimes use be able to instead of quot can quot or quot could quot for ability Be able to is possible in all tenses but quot can quot is possible only in the present and quot could quot is possible only in the past for ability
